The2001 Michigan State Spartans football team representedMichigan State University as a member of theBig Ten Conference during the2001 NCAA Division I-A football season. Led by second-year head coachBobby Williams, the Spartans compiled an overall record of 7–5 with a mark of 3–5 in conference play, tying for eighth place in the Big Ten. Michigan State was invited to theSilicon Valley Football Classic, where the Spartans defeatedFresno State. The team played home games atSpartan Stadium inEast Lansing, Michigan.

The controversial final play of thehome game against Michigan on November 3 led to a change in the official timekeeping policy of the Big Ten Conference. Beginning in 2002, a neutral official appointed by the Big Ten keeps track of the game time on the field.

Note: The Missouri game originally scheduled for September 15 was rescheduled to December 1 because of theSeptember 11 attacks.
